Nature is also a significant component of Arlington’s local attractions. The city features numerous parks and outdoor activities that invite guests to enjoy the Texan air. River Legacy Parks offers walking and biking trails, picnic areas, and viewpoints along the Trinity River, ensuring guests get a taste of Arlington’s natural beauty.
